TABLE { padding: 0px; }
BODY { margin: 0px; background-color: #DAE4E1; }

.gradl { background-color: #91B3A6; background-image: url('jan bokszczanin/gradl.gif'); background-repeat: repeat-y; }
.gradr { background-color: #91B3A6; background-image: url('jan bokszczanin/gradr.gif'); background-repeat: repeat-y; background-position: top right; }
.gradm { background-color: #91B3A6; background-image: url('jan bokszczanin/gradm.gif'); background-repeat: repeat-y; background-position: top center; }
.content { text-align: center; background-color: #91B3A6; }

.null { font-size: 1px; color: transparent; }

.menuF	{ text-align: left; width: 118px; cursor: pointer; text-decoration: none; color: #344B43; }
.menu	{ text-align: center; cursor: pointer; text-decoration: none; color: #344B43; }
.menuL	{ text-align: right; width: 68px; cursor: pointer; text-decoration: none; color: #344B43; }
.menuOverF { text-align: left; width: 118px; cursor: pointer; text-decoration: underline; color: #111A16; }
.menuOver { text-align: center; cursor: pointer; text-decoration: underline; color: #111A16; }
.menuOverL { text-align: right; width: 68px; cursor: pointer; text-decoration: underline; color: #111A16; }
A:link.menuLink { font-family: Verdana; font-size: 11px; text-decoration: none; color: #344B43; font-weight: bold; }
A:visited.menuLink { font-family: Verdana; font-size: 11px; text-decoration: none; color: #344B43; font-weight: bold; }
A:active.menuLink { font-family: Verdana; font-size: 11px; text-decoration: underline; color: #111A16; font-weight: bold; }
A:hover.menuLink { font-family: Verdana; font-size: 11px; text-decoration: underline; color: #111A16; font-weight: bold; }

A:link.toplink { font-family: Verdana; font-size: 12px; letter-spacing: 1px; text-decoration: none; color: #344B43; font-weight: bold; }
A:visited.toplink { font-family: Verdana; font-size: 12px; letter-spacing: 1px; text-decoration: none; color: #344B43; font-weight: bold; }
A:active.toplink { font-family: Verdana; font-size: 12px; letter-spacing: 1px; text-decoration: underline; color: #111A16; font-weight: bold; }
A:hover.toplink { font-family: Verdana; font-size: 12px; letter-spacing: 1px; text-decoration: underline; color: #111A16; font-weight: bold; }

A:link.toplinkwide { font-family: Verdana; font-size: 12px; letter-spacing: 6px; text-decoration: none; color: #344B43; font-weight: bold; }
A:visited.toplinkwide { font-family: Verdana; font-size: 12px; letter-spacing: 6px; text-decoration: none; color: #344B43; font-weight: bold; }
A:active.toplinkwide { font-family: Verdana; font-size: 12px; letter-spacing: 6px; text-decoration: underline; color: #111A16; font-weight: bold; }
A:hover.toplinkwide { font-family: Verdana; font-size: 12px; letter-spacing: 6px; text-decoration: underline; color: #111A16; font-weight: bold; }

A:link.toplinknarrow { font-family: Verdana; font-size: 12px; letter-spacing: -2px; text-decoration: none; color: #344B43; font-weight: bold; }
A:visited.toplinknarrow { font-family: Verdana; font-size: 12px; letter-spacing: -2px; text-decoration: none; color: #344B43; font-weight: bold; }
A:active.toplinknarrow { font-family: Verdana; font-size: 12px; letter-spacing: -2px; text-decoration: underline; color: #111A16; font-weight: bold; }
A:hover.toplinknarrow { font-family: Verdana; font-size: 12px; letter-spacing: -2px; text-decoration: underline; color: #111A16; font-weight: bold; }

.title { font-family: Verdana; font-size: 18px; color: #090D0B; font-weight: bold; letter-spacing: 1px; vertical-align: top; padding-top: 23px; }
.titles { font-family: Verdana; font-size: 14px; color: #090D0B; font-weight: bold; vertical-align: top; padding-top: 23px; }
.titlexs { font-family: Verdana; font-size: 13px; color: #090D0B; font-weight: bold; vertical-align: top; padding-top: 23px; }
.subtitle { font-family: Verdana; font-size: 13px; color: #090D0B; font-weight: bold; letter-spacing: 2px; vertical-align: bottom; padding-bottom: 3px; }

.textbase { font-family: Verdana; font-size: 11px; color: #090D0B; }
.scroll { overflow: auto; height: 450px; width: 550px; scrollbar-face-color: #91B3A6; }
.scrolll { overflow: auto; height: 440px; width: 550px; scrollbar-face-color: #91B3A6; }
.scrolls { overflow: auto; height: 200px; width: 550px; scrollbar-face-color: #91B3A6; }
.scrollw { overflow: auto; height: 450px; width: 700px; scrollbar-face-color: #91B3A6; }
.scrolln { overflow: auto; height: 450px; width: 300px; scrollbar-face-color: #91B3A6; }
.lighter { background-color: #AAC4BA; padding: 3px; }

.listtitle { font-family: Verdana; font-size: 12px; color: #090D0B; font-weight: bold; letter-spacing: 1px; text-align: center; }
.listitem { font-family: Verdana; font-size: 12px; color: #090D0B; }
.listitems { font-family: Verdana; font-size: 10px; color: #090D0B; }
.listitemm { font-family: Verdana; font-size: 12px; color: #090D0B; }
.listiteml { font-family: Verdana; font-size: 12px; letter-spacing: 1px; color: #090D0B; }
.listitemxl { font-family: Verdana; font-size: 14px; letter-spacing: 1px; line-height: 1.4; color: #090D0B; }
.listsep { border-bottom: 1px dashed #344B43; }
.listitemrow { cursor: pointer; }
.listitembld { font-family: Verdana; font-size: 10px; color: #090D0B; font-weight: bold; }

A:link.listitem { font-family: Verdana; font-size: 11px; text-decoration: none; color: #090D0B; }
A:visited.listitem { font-family: Verdana; font-size: 11px; text-decoration: none; color: #090D0B; }
A:active.listitem { font-family: Verdana; font-size: 11px; text-decoration: underline; color: #090D0B; }
A:hover.listitem { font-family: Verdana; font-size: 11px; text-decoration: underline; color: #090D0B; }
A:link.listiteml { font-family: Verdana; font-size: 12px; letter-spacing: 1px; text-decoration: none; color: #090D0B; }
A:visited.listiteml { font-family: Verdana; font-size: 12px; letter-spacing: 1px; text-decoration: none; color: #090D0B; }
A:active.listiteml { font-family: Verdana; font-size: 12px; letter-spacing: 1px; text-decoration: none; color: #090D0B; }
A:hover.listiteml { font-family: Verdana; font-size: 12px; letter-spacing: 1px; text-decoration: none; color: #090D0B; }
A:link.listitemxl { font-family: Verdana; font-size: 14px; letter-spacing: 1px; line-height: 1.4; text-decoration: none; color: #090D0B; }
A:visited.listitemxl { font-family: Verdana; font-size: 14px; letter-spacing: 1px; line-height: 1.4; text-decoration: none; color: #090D0B; }
A:active.listitemxl { font-family: Verdana; font-size: 14px; letter-spacing: 1px; line-height: 1.4; text-decoration: none; color: #090D0B; }
A:hover.listitemxl { font-family: Verdana; font-size: 14px; letter-spacing: 1px; line-height: 1.4; text-decoration: none; color: #090D0B; }
A:link.listitem2 { font-family: Verdana; font-size: 12px; text-decoration: none; color: #090D0B; }
A:visited.listitem2 { font-family: Verdana; font-size: 12px; text-decoration: none; color: #090D0B; }
A:active.listitem2 { font-family: Verdana; font-size: 12px; text-decoration: none; color: #090D0B; }
A:hover.listitem2 { font-family: Verdana; font-size: 12px; text-decoration: none; color: #090D0B; }
A:link.listitemm { font-family: Verdana; font-size: 12px; text-decoration: none; color: #090D0B; }
A:visited.listitemm { font-family: Verdana; font-size: 12px; text-decoration: none; color: #090D0B; }
A:active.listitemm { font-family: Verdana; font-size: 12px; text-decoration: none; color: #090D0B; }
A:hover.listitemm { font-family: Verdana; font-size: 12px; text-decoration: none; color: #090D0B; }
A:link.listitemxlu { font-family: Verdana; font-size: 14px; font-weight: bold; letter-spacing: 1px; line-height: 1.4; text-decoration: underline; color: #090D0B; }
A:visited.listitemxlu { font-family: Verdana; font-size: 14px; font-weight: bold; letter-spacing: 1px; line-height: 1.4; text-decoration: underline; color: #090D0B; }
A:active.listitemxlu { font-family: Verdana; font-size: 14px; font-weight: bold; letter-spacing: 1px; line-height: 1.4; text-decoration: underline; color: #090D0B; }
A:hover.listitemxlu { font-family: Verdana; font-size: 14px; font-weight: bold; letter-spacing: 1px; line-height: 1.4; text-decoration: underline; color: #090D0B; }

.titleretL { font-size: 1px; color: transparent; text-align: left; vertical-align: bottom; padding-bottom: 5px; padding-left: 3px; }
.titleretC { font-size: 1px; color: transparent; text-align: center; vertical-align: bottom; padding-bottom: 5px; }
.titleret { font-size: 1px; color: transparent; text-align: right; vertical-align: bottom; padding-bottom: 5px; padding-right: 3px; }
A:link.retlink { font-family: Verdana; font-size: 9px; letter-spacing: 1px; text-decoration: none; color: #344B43; font-weisght: bold; }
A:visited.retlink { font-family: Verdana; font-size: 9px; letter-spacing: 1px; text-decoration: none; color: #344B43; font-wesight: bold; }
A:active.retlink { font-family: Verdana; font-size: 9px; letter-spacing: 1px; text-decoration: underline; color: #111A16; fonts-weight: bold; }
A:hover.retlink { font-family: Verdana; font-size: 9px; letter-spacing: 1px; text-decoration: underline; color: #111A16; font-sweight: bold; }

.itemtitle { font-family: Verdana; font-size: 15px; color: #090D0B; font-weight: bold; letter-spacing: 1px; }
.itemtitles { font-family: Verdana; font-size: 13px; color: #090D0B; font-weight: bold; letter-spacing: 1px; padding-top: 5px; }
.itemdatadescr { font-family: Verdana; font-size: 12px; color: #090D0B; }
.itemdatadescrv { font-family: Verdana; font-size: 12px; color: #090D0B; vertical-align: top; }
.itemdata { font-family: Verdana; font-size: 14px; letter-spacing: 1px; color: #090D0B; }
.itemdatal { font-family: Verdana; font-size: 12px; letter-spacing: 1px; font-weight: bold; color: #090D0B; }
.itemimage { float: left; margin-right: 15px; margin-bottom: 5px; }
.itemdescr { font-family: Verdana; font-size: 12px; line-height: 1.5; color: #090D0B; text-align: justify; padding-right: 15px; }
.itemdescrnoimg { font-family: Verdana; font-size: 12px; line-height: 1.5; color: #090D0B; text-align: justify; }
.itemlist { list-style-type: circle; margin-top: 0px; margin-bottom: 5px; margin-right: 0px; }
.itemlist LI { font-family: Verdana; font-size: 13px; letter-spacing: 1px; font-weight: bold; color: #090D0B; }
.itemident { padding-left: 10px; }
.itemdatapadded { font-family: Verdana; font-size: 13px; letter-spacing: 1px; line-height: 1.4; color: #090D0B; padding-left: 30px; }
.itemdatapdnarrow { font-family: Verdana; font-size: 13px; color: #090D0B; padding-left: 30px; line-height: 1.4; }

.imgEnlarge { display: none; position: absolute; border: 2px outset #DAE4E1; }
.imgClose { height: 25px; font-family: Verdana; font-size: 18px; font-weight: bold; text-align: right; background-color: #91B3A6; color: #DAE4E1; cursor: pointer; }
.imgZoomDesc { height: 25px; font-family: Verdana; font-size: 18px; font-weight: bold; text-align: center; background-color: #91B3A6; color: #DAE4E1; cursor: pointer; }

.playerholder { vertical-align: bottom; padding-bottom: 3px; }
.playercloser { visibility: hidden; vertical-align: bottom; padding-bottom: 15px; font-family: Verdana; font-size: 18px; font-weight: bold; text-align: center; background-color: #91B3A6; color: #DAE4E1; cursor: pointer; }
.playerdiv { display: none; font-family: Verdana; font-size: 1px; }
.playerclosers { vertical-align: bottom; padding-bottom: 15px; font-family: Verdana; font-size: 18px; font-weight: bold; text-align: center; background-color: #91B3A6; color: #DAE4E1; cursor: pointer; }
.playerdivs { font-family: Verdana; font-size: 1px; }

.kontakt_in { font-family: Verdana; font-size: 17px; color: #090D0B; letter-spacing: 2px; padding-bottom: 20px; }
.kontakt_ad { font-family: Verdana; font-size: 14px; color: #090D0B; letter-spacing: 1px; padding-bottom: 20px; line-height: 1.6; }
.kontakt_tl { font-family: Verdana; font-size: 14px; color: #090D0B; letter-spacing: 1px; padding-bottom: 20px; line-height: 1.6; }
.kontakt_an { font-family: Verdana; font-size: 17px; color: #090D0B; letter-spacing: 2px; padding-bottom: 20px; }
.kontakt_at { font-family: Verdana; font-size: 14px; color: #090D0B; letter-spacing: 1px; padding-bottom: 20px; line-height: 1.6; }
A:link.kontakt_em { font-family: Verdana; font-size: 14px; letter-spacing: 1px; text-decoration: none; color: #090D0B; }
A:visited.kontakt_em { font-family: Verdana; font-size: 14px; letter-spacing: 1px; text-decoration: none; color: #090D0B; }
A:active.kontakt_em { font-family: Verdana; font-size: 14px; letter-spacing: 1px; text-decoration: underline; color: #3A5A4D; }
A:hover.kontakt_em { font-family: Verdana; font-size: 14px; letter-spacing: 1px; text-decoration: underline; color: #3A5A4D; }
A:link.kontakt_ae { font-family: Verdana; font-size: 14px; letter-spacing: 1px; text-decoration: none; color: #090D0B; }
A:visited.kontakt_ae { font-family: Verdana; font-size: 14px; letter-spacing: 1px; text-decoration: none; color: #090D0B; }
A:active.kontakt_ae { font-family: Verdana; font-size: 14px; letter-spacing: 1px; text-decoration: underline; color: #3A5A4D; }
A:hover.kontakt_ae { font-family: Verdana; font-size: 14px; letter-spacing: 1px; text-decoration: underline; color: #3A5A4D; }

